Sometimes the arrogance of public officials is breathtaking.

It has been reported to CNHT that at a recent Monadnock Regional School District meeting, Monadnock citizens questioned the Chairman, Gene White, about his use of the reverse 911 system. This system was installed for the purpose of notifying parents and residents of emergencies using robocalls.

Chairman White apparently readily admitted that he had indeed done so and his voice as well as the Budget Committee Chairman’s voice were on the calls that asked residents to get out and vote in favor of the school contract.

This is clearly illegal. Taxpayer funded public services are not to be used for any sort of electioneering, by law.

When reminded of this, Mr. White became loud and the Board voted to remove him from the Chairman’s position for the night because he became so out of control. Apparently Mr. White had in the past, taken a swing at one of the citizens who had questioned him at a public meeting.

This type of illegal activity is so common that parents do not think twice, for example, about their children being used to carry home political literature, teachers’ government funded websites being used to promote their job contracts, or email lists of parents being used to promote political messages.
